Okay, so I will finally do a build thread but I am still working through the details in my head. I have always wanted an Anemone cube. I have one of the most unique BTA in my big reef and absolutely love him, but he is taking up a quarter of the tank. So fast forward and I come across an incredible deal at my LFS for a 60 Gallon cube. I went there to trade in some corals and the tank basically cost nothing so I said lets do it. Now to the questions part.

I am curing old rock right now, and will begin to cycle it after the bleach cure is complete. So still a ways out

Flow. Can I get a away with an MP 10 to provide enough flow in the cube for the anemone? or should I go with an MP 40?

Stocking the tank..... I think I would like to do 7 orange or pink skunks. I plan on purchasing 1 more large anemone to add with mine, and the rest will be small and will need to mature. I am worried that the small ones, if the clowns try to host in them will get beat up and die. Is this a legitimate concern or just a fear? Do 7 sound like a good number for skunks? Would like to purchase them and get them into QT in the next couple of weeks for 60 days of full QT before I add them to the tank.

I have a 1.5 foot magnifica anemone in a 20G peninsula with an MP10. I just added it last week but it's looking very happy. I also seeded my tank with marine pure and rocks from my established tank, so I didn't have to cycle. I added two clowns same day. I'm also using XR15 pro gen 5 lights.
